EN 856-4SP is a hydraulic hose model specified by the International Organization for Standardization, which is particularly suitable for high-pressure working environments. 32 usually refers to the inner diameter of the hose. The four-layer wire winding structure gives this hose extremely high compressive strength and wear resistance, making it an indispensable and important component in many industrial fields.
The structural design of the four-layer wire-wound high-pressure hose is very precise. It consists of an inner layer, a middle layer, an outer layer and four layers of wire winding. The inner layer is usually made of oil-resistant and wear-resistant synthetic rubber material, which is responsible for direct contact with the transmitted hydraulic fluid to ensure the purity and transmission efficiency of the fluid. The middle layer is usually one or more layers of fiber or rubber reinforcement layers to provide additional strength and stability. The outer layer is another layer of oil-resistant and weather-resistant synthetic rubber, which mainly plays a protective role to prevent the external environment from damaging the inside of the hose. The most critical part is the four-layer steel wire winding layer. These steel wires are tightly wound between the inner and outer layers at a specific angle and tension, forming an indestructible barrier that can withstand extremely high working pressures and prevent the hose from expanding or bursting under high pressure.
In terms of material selection, this high-pressure hose usually uses high-quality rubber and steel wire. The rubber material not only needs to have excellent oil resistance, wear resistance and weather resistance, but also needs to have a certain elasticity and flexibility to adapt to complex and changing working environments. The steel wire needs to have high strength and good corrosion resistance to ensure that the hose will not fail due to rust or breakage of the steel wire during long-term use.
The operating temperature range of EN 856-4SP 32 four-layer steel wire winding high-pressure hose is usually wide, and it can maintain stable performance in extreme environments. Generally speaking, this hose can work normally in the temperature range of -40℃ to +100℃ (even higher temperatures in some special models). This is due to its high-quality rubber material and precise manufacturing process, which enables the hose to maintain its stable physical and chemical properties under various harsh working conditions.
In terms of application areas, EN 856-4SP 32 four-layer steel wire wound high-pressure hose covers almost all industrial fields that require high-pressure hydraulic transmission. For example, in the field of engineering machinery, large excavators, cranes, rollers and other equipment widely use this hose to transmit hydraulic oil to ensure the normal operation of the equipment. In port loading and unloading equipment, this hose also plays an important role, providing stable and reliable hydraulic power for loading and unloading machinery. In addition, in industries such as oil drilling, metallurgy, and mining, this high-pressure hose is also favored for its excellent pressure resistance and wear resistance.

However, despite the many advantages of EN 856-4SP 32 four-layer steel wire wound high-pressure hose, some matters need to be paid attention to in actual use to ensure the stability and safety of its performance. First, excessive bending and twisting of the hose should be avoided during installation to avoid damage to the internal structure of the hose. Secondly, the appearance and performance status of the hose should be checked regularly during use, and if abnormalities are found, they should be replaced in time to avoid safety accidents. In addition, during storage and transportation, care should be taken to avoid damage to the hose by high temperature, humidity and corrosive substances.
In terms of production technology, the production process of EN 856-4SP 32 four-layer steel wire wound high-pressure hose is very complicated and requires high-precision equipment and technical support. From the selection of raw materials to mixing, extrusion, winding, vulcanization and other production links, strict control of quality and technical parameters are required to ensure the performance and quality of the final product. For example, during the extrusion process, the extrusion speed and temperature of the rubber need to be precisely controlled to ensure the uniformity and thickness of the inner layer; during the winding process, the tension, angle and spacing of the steel wire need to be precisely controlled to ensure the stability and strength of the winding layer; during the vulcanization process, the vulcanization temperature and time need to be precisely controlled to ensure the stability of the physical and chemical properties of the hose.
